  1. Finance Directo

Finance managers prepare financial reports, direct investment activities, and develop plans for their organization's long-term financial goals. A person working as a financial manager in Egypt typically earns around EGP 17,800 per month. Salaries range from EGP 8,360 (lowest) to EGP 28,100 (highest). 

  1. Data Analyst

 

A data analyst is a person who systematically applies statistical and/or logical techniques to describe and illustrate, condense and summarize and evaluate data. The average salary for a data analyst in Cairo, Egypt is EGP 214,598 per year and EGP 103 per hour. The average salary range for a data analyst is EGP 153,198 to EGP 269,867. On average, a bachelor's degree is the highest level of education for a data analyst.

 

  1. Physician/Doctor 

A prerequisite for the provision of quality health services is the availability of human capital. Without qualified, specialized staff, even the best medical facilities with the most modern medical equipment are not efficient. By 2030, an additional 88,000 doctors, 73,000 additional nurses and 18,000 pharmacists will be needed. a person working as a doctor in Egypt usually earns around EGP 21,600 per month. Salaries range from EGP 7,940 (lowest average) to EGP 36,500 (highest average, actual maximum is higher).

Project Manager

By 2027, the project management-oriented workforce across seven project-oriented sectors is expected to grow by 33 percent or almost 22 million new jobs. By 2027, employers might need nearly 88 million employees in project management-oriented roles. The project manager is the person who edits a team's work to achieve all project goals within given constraints. A project manager in Egypt typically earns around EGP 10,300 per month. Salaries range from EGP 5,440 (lowest) to EGP 15,600 (highest).

Teachers/Lecturers

A good education can help develop a country. This quality requires good teachers and lecturers. A person working in teaching/education in Egypt typically earns around EGP 9,760 per month. Salaries range from EGP 4,680 (lowest average) to EGP 17,800 (highest average, actual maximum is higher).

Chemical Engineer

Chemical engineers apply the principles of chemistry, biology, physics, and mathematics to solve problems involving the manufacture or use of chemicals, fuels, medicines, food, and many other products. A person working as a chemical engineer in Egypt typically earns around EGP 8,940 per month. Salaries range from EGP 4,110 (lowest) to EGP 14,200 (highest).

Sales Manager

Sales managers take full control of the sales teams of organizations. They determine sales goals, evaluate data, and create training programs for organizations' salespeople. A person working as a sales manager in Egypt typically earns around EGP 15,300 per month. Salaries range from EGP 7,200 (lowest) to EGP 24,200 (highest).

Personnel Manager

Personal manager who oversees the hiring process of a company or organization, from recruiting to interviewing and hiring new employees. Chef 

A person working as a chef in Egypt typically earns around EGP 5,660 per month. Salaries range from EGP 2,940 (lowest) to EGP 8,660 (highest)
These jobs are drastically based on experience, skills, gender, or location.
